Called “the crown jewel of fan festivals throughout baseball,” by Bob Castellini, President and Chief Executive Office of the Cincinnati Reds, Redsfest is certainly one hot ticket in town. This year’s Redsfest will be packed with players and an event that showcases some of baseballs’s greats – and not only those from the current team such as Bronson Arroyo, Jay Bruce and Brandon Phillips, but Redsfest features a special 20th anniversary tribute to the 1990 World Series Champions, highlighting Ron Oester, Erik Davis, Lou Piniella and many more.
Kathryn lets us in on the myriad of reasons one should come to Redsfest this year. Come for the players and get your balls, bats, baseball cards and baseball tickets autographed. And come for the fun – there’s a ton of activities for kids of all ages. Specifically, kids this year can play Joey Votto in Sony PlayStation’s “Fan Versus Votto” contest with one player competing against him in a homerun contest. What a memory of a lifetime.
